create ISO with additional files and kickstart
Hi!
I'm trying to create a CD including kickstart scripts and other files (Fedora 8). The image I have created boots, but at one point it says that the CD Media is not a "Fedora 8 CD". If the image is create without additional files I can install the system. What I did: 1)- Get an image and mounted with mount -o loop isofile.iso /mnt 2)- cp -r /mnt/* /tmp/cd/ 3)- added the kickstart files to the /tmp/cd/isolinux/ directory and a folder called extra in the CD root dir (/tmp/cd/extras) with additional files (RPMS and scripts). 4)- create the image file with in the CD root directory: mkisofs -o ../cd.iso -b isolinux/isolinux.bin -c isolinux/boot.cat -no-emul-boot -boot-load-size 4 -boot-info-table -R -J -v -T . Any idea? Thanks in advance. Regards, Augusto |
Solved
The files .discinfo and .treeinfo were missing in my new image.
Regards, Augusto |
Quote:
You seem to have gotten yours to work. Can you provide some more information? I put a ks.cfg file in the isolinux directory and built the iso image as you indicated. The disk comes up to the boot prompt, I didn't put in a any args, just pressed return hoping it would detect the ks.cfg file and use it. Unfortunately it did not. The machine continued into the standard boot screen. How do you get it to detect and use the ks file? Do I need to specify ks on the boot line? Thanks! -- Andrew |
Add the ks.cfg in the isolinux dir did not work for me. The correct place to put is in the root directory of the CD/DVD. To be able to access from the boot menu, you have to type a parameter to the boot:
ks=cdrom:/ks.cfg or you can add it to the isolinux.cfg file. In my isolinux.cfg file I have another label: label linux menu label ^Install from kickstart kernel vmlinuz append initrd=initrd.img ks=cdrom:/ks.cfg Let me know if t worked! Regards, Augusto |
Quote:
|
May this would be helpful to you.
|
Quote:
Best regards, Augusto |
All times are GMT -5. The time now is 11:56 PM. |